tpwallet在日常支付场景中提供授权撤销能力,但如果取消授权失败,会带来交易中断、资金安全隐患以及对商户与用户信任的影响。本文从故障现象、原因分析、治理策略以及行业趋势等维度展开讨论,力求给出可落地的排查路线和改进方向。\n\n一、现象描述与典型场景\n在移动端、SDK接入或商户后台触发的授权撤销流程中,若系统无法正确撤销授权,可能表现为:用户页面长时间停留在撤销授权状态、跨机构调用返回错误码、回调通知迟迟未到、以及后续的交易不能正常发起或被拒绝。大量并发场景下的重试也可能放大延迟,影响结算时效与风控判定。\n\n二、可能的原因分析\n1) 技术层面:令牌续期、OAuth/JWT等授权凭证的失效、回调签名校验失败、票据缓存未同步、以及分布式事务中的幂等性问题。2) 网络层面:网关、反向代理或CDN缓存导致的旧授权状态未清理、超时重试策略不当。3) 架构层面:微服务拆分后的状态机不同步、事件溯源缺失、异步通知丢失。4) 数据与日志:数据库写入失败、日志不可达或日志采样导致排错困难。5) 安全与治理:密钥轮换、权限变更未同步、设备绑定策略变化。\n\n三、对高效支付系统的影响\n授权撤销是支付工作流的关键节点,失败会引发交易链路中断、风控误判和合规隐患。系统需具备快速回退、幂等处理和完整的状态可观测性,以

确保用户体验和资金安全。\n\n四、应对策略与最佳实践\n1) 设计端到端的撤销授权流程:建立状态机、确保幂等键、对回调做严格签名校验;2) 强化可观测性:集中日志、追踪ID、跨系统的分布式追踪;3) 重试与兜底:设定合理的限幅与退避策略,确保在网络异常时能回滚到安全状态;4) 安全策略:多因素验证、设备绑定、密钥生命周期管理、数据传输加密与签名校验;5) 数据治理:确保授权相关的数据在事件源和数据库中一致性,必要时使用补偿性事务;6) 安全合规:监控授权撤销的速率与异常行为,及时告警与审计。\n\n五、哈希率与支付管理的关系\n在基于区块链或分布式账本的支付场景中,哈希率反映网络的算力与安全性。高哈希率通常意味着更高的不可否认性和抗篡改能力,但也带来算力成本与延迟的权衡。将哈希率维度纳入安全策略与透明度设计,可以提升对交易溯源的信任,但需与合规的隐私保护、数据最小化原则协同。\n\n六、技术变革与创新支付管理系统\n微服务、事件驱动架构、可观测性平台与自动化合规工具,是提升授权撤销鲁棒性的关键。创新支付管理系统应当以容错、低延迟、可审计为目标,同时通过数据治理與风险控制实现更高的信任度。\n\n七、案例要点与教训\n从实际故障排查来看,排错清单应覆盖:授权状态对比、缓存同步、回调验证、网络延时、日志完整性、权限变更记录和密钥轮换记录等。\n\n八、结论与未来展望\ntpwallet的授权撤销问题提醒我们,支付系统的健壮性不仅来自单点的故

障处理,更来自全栈的观测、治理与创新能力的叠加。未来的高效支付将通过统一的状态管理、可验证的交易账本和更智能的风控模型来实现更高的可用性与安全性。
作者:Alex Li发布时间:2025-09-13 02:22:56
评论
CryptoNerd99
很实用的故障诊断框架,便于直接落地排查。
月影
关于哈希率的说明很有启发性,区块链支付场景的安全性需要更透明的溯源机制。
TechGuru
干货,尤其是幂等性和回调签名的设计要点,值得工程团队借鉴。
小明
希望后续能给出具体的监控指标与告警阈值参考。